  • Is it common to pay with cash or card in Japan?

    While card payments are becoming increasingly common, especially in larger cities and tourist areas, cash remains king in Japan. Many smaller establishments, particularly in rural areas, may only accept cash. It's advisable to carry sufficient yen, especially for smaller purchases.

  • Is the driving culture in Japan considered safe for tourists?

    Japan has a very efficient and generally safe public transport system, so driving isn't usually necessary for tourists. Driving in Japan can be challenging for those unfamiliar with its rules and customs, with narrow roads and complex intersections. While safe for locals, it might be stressful for visitors unaccustomed to the system.

  • Are there any important traditions to honour while travelling in Japan?

    Bowing is a common greeting and shows respect. Removing your shoes before entering homes and some restaurants is customary. Being mindful of noise levels, especially in public transport and residential areas, is appreciated. Learning a few basic Japanese phrases, like 'arigato' (thank you), can go a long way.

  • Are there any noteworthy festivals unique to Japan?

    Japan boasts many unique festivals! The Gion Matsuri in Kyoto, a month-long celebration with elaborate floats, is famous. The Nebuta Matsuri in Aomori features giant, illuminated floats depicting historical figures and mythical creatures. Smaller, local festivals are abundant throughout the year, each with its own distinct character and traditions.

  • Are there parts of Japan with consistently good weather throughout the year?

    No part of Japan has consistently good weather year-round. The country experiences distinct seasons. Areas like Okinawa in the south tend to have milder winters and warmer summers compared to the northern regions, but even there, weather can vary.
  • What are the emergency contacts for medical or security situations in Japan?

    For medical emergencies, dial 119. For police or security situations, dial 110. It's advisable to inform your hotel or accommodation of your travel plans and keep emergency contact information readily accessible.
